.pur-events .pur-event-card,.pur-events .pur-event-card *{border-radius:0!important}.pur-events .pur-event-card{border-radius:16px!important;overflow:hidden!important}.pur-events .pur-event-card__btn,.pur-events .pur-event-card__btn:link,.pur-events .pur-event-card__btn:visited{border-radius:100px!important}.pur-events .pur-event-card__banner,.pur-events .pur-event-card__img,.pur-events .pur-event-card__img-photo,.pur-events .pur-event-card__img-wrap{border-radius:0!important;-webkit-border-radius:0!important;-moz-border-radius:0!important}.pur-events{background:linear-gradient(160deg,#f4f6f8,#eef0f2 50%,#f0f4f5);font-family:Montserrat,Arial,sans-serif;padding:4rem 0 3rem;width:100%}.pur-events__header{margin:0 auto 1.5rem;max-width:760px;padding:0 24px;text-align:center}.pur-events__eyebrow{color:#88dbdf;font-size:11px;font-weight:600;letter-spacing:.22em;margin:0 0 12px}.pur-events__eyebrow,.pur-events__title{font-family:Montserrat,Arial,sans-serif;text-transform:uppercase}.pur-events__title{color:#2c2c2a;font-size:clamp(22px,3.2vw,44px);font-weight:300;letter-spacing:.18em;margin:0 0 16px;-webkit-font-smoothing:antialiased}.pur-events__divider{background:#88dbdf;border-radius:2px;height:1.5px;margin:0 auto;width:48px}.pur-countdown{align-items:center;background-image:url(https://243076641.fs1.hubspotusercontent-na2.net/hubfs/243076641/Pur%20Skin%20Clinic/PUR%20-%20HubSpot%20-%20Hero%20-%201920x1080-KIRK%20Int.png);background-position:50%;background-size:cover;border-radius:16px!important;display:flex;justify-content:center;margin:2rem auto;max-width:1200px;min-height:200px;overflow:hidden;position:relative}.pur-countdown__overlay{background:rgba(20,40,50,.45);inset:0;position:absolute}.pur-countdown__inner{align-items:center;display:flex;flex-direction:column;padding:32px 24px;position:relative;width:100%;z-index:2}.pur-countdown__label{color:#88dbdf;font-size:10px;font-weight:600;letter-spacing:.22em;margin:0 0 6px;text-transform:uppercase}.pur-countdown__event{color:#fff;font-size:clamp(16px,2.5vw,24px);font-weight:300;letter-spacing:.18em;margin:0 0 4px;text-align:center;text-transform:uppercase}.pur-countdown__sub{color:hsla(0,0%,100%,.7);font-family:Lato,Arial,sans-serif;font-size:13px;font-weight:300;margin:0 0 20px;text-align:center}.pur-countdown__timer{display:flex;gap:12px;justify-content:center}.pur-countdown__unit{align-items:center;display:flex;flex-direction:column;gap:4px}.pur-countdown__num{background:hsla(0,0%,100%,.12);border:1px solid hsla(0,0%,100%,.2);border-radius:8px!important;color:#fff;font-size:clamp(22px,3vw,32px);font-weight:700;line-height:1;min-width:56px;padding:10px 4px;text-align:center}.pur-countdown__lbl{color:hsla(0,0%,100%,.6);font-size:9px;font-weight:600;letter-spacing:.15em;text-transform:uppercase}.pur-countdown__sep{align-self:center;color:hsla(0,0%,100%,.4);font-size:24px;font-weight:300;margin-top:-14px}.pur-countdown__cta,.pur-countdown__cta:link,.pur-countdown__cta:visited{background:#88dbdf!important;color:#fff!important;display:inline-block!important;margin-top:20px;padding:12px 32px!important;-webkit-text-fill-color:#fff!important;border:none!important;border-radius:100px!important;font-family:Montserrat,Arial,sans-serif!important;font-size:11px!important;font-weight:700!important;letter-spacing:.15em!important;text-decoration:none!important;text-transform:uppercase!important;transition:background .2s ease}.pur-countdown__cta:hover{background:#6ccdd1!important}.pur-events__hint{align-items:center;color:#88dbdf;display:flex;font-family:Montserrat,Arial,sans-serif;font-size:10px;font-weight:600;gap:10px;justify-content:center;letter-spacing:.2em;margin:0 0 1rem;text-align:center;text-transform:uppercase}.pur-events__slider-wrap{overflow:hidden;padding:0 0 1.5rem;position:relative}.pur-events__track{display:flex;gap:24px;padding:8px 40px;transition:transform .4s cubic-bezier(.25,.46,.45,.94);will-change:transform}.pur-events__peek{background:linear-gradient(90deg,transparent,rgba(240,244,245,.97));bottom:1.5rem;pointer-events:none;position:absolute;right:0;top:0;width:64px}.pur-event-card{background:#fff;border:.5px solid #d3d1c7!important;border-radius:16px!important;display:flex;flex:0 0 300px;flex-direction:column;overflow:hidden!important;transition:transform .2s ease,box-shadow .2s ease}.pur-event-card:hover{box-shadow:0 8px 28px rgba(136,219,223,.18);transform:translateY(-4px)}.pur-event-card__banner{align-items:center;border-radius:0!important;-webkit-border-radius:0!important;color:#fff;display:flex;flex-shrink:0;font-family:Montserrat,Arial,sans-serif;font-size:9px;font-weight:700;height:28px;justify-content:center;letter-spacing:.18em;text-transform:uppercase;width:100%}.pur-event-card__banner--kirkland{background:#88dbdf!important}.pur-event-card__banner--seattle{background:#3d7fa3!important}.pur-event-card__banner--edmonds{background:#5dadc5!important}.pur-event-card__img{align-items:center;border-radius:0!important;-webkit-border-radius:0!important;display:flex;flex-shrink:0;height:220px;justify-content:center;width:100%}.pur-event-card__img-label{color:hsla(0,0%,100%,.9);font-family:Montserrat,Arial,sans-serif;font-size:10px;font-weight:600;letter-spacing:.15em;text-transform:uppercase}.pur-event-card__img-wrap{flex-shrink:0;height:220px;overflow:hidden}.pur-event-card__img-photo,.pur-event-card__img-wrap{border-radius:0!important;-webkit-border-radius:0!important;width:100%}.pur-event-card__img-photo{display:block;height:100%;object-fit:cover;object-position:top;transition:transform .3s ease}.pur-event-card:hover .pur-event-card__img-photo{transform:scale(1.03)}.pur-event-card__body{border-radius:0!important;display:flex;flex:1;flex-direction:column;gap:8px;padding:18px 20px 20px}.pur-event-card__date{color:#88dbdf;font-size:10px;font-weight:600;letter-spacing:.1em;margin:0;text-transform:uppercase}.pur-event-card__title{color:#2c2c2a;font-size:15px;font-weight:600;letter-spacing:.03em;line-height:1.3;margin:0}.pur-event-card__desc{color:#5f5e5a;flex:1;font-family:Lato,Arial,sans-serif;font-size:13px;font-weight:300;line-height:1.65;margin:0}.pur-event-card__fine{color:#b4b2a9;font-family:Lato,Arial,sans-serif;font-size:11px;font-style:italic;margin:0}.pur-event-card__btn,.pur-event-card__btn:link,.pur-event-card__btn:visited{background:#88dbdf!important;border-radius:100px!important;color:#fff!important;display:inline-block!important;margin-top:4px;padding:11px 24px!important;-webkit-text-fill-color:#fff!important;align-self:flex-start;font-family:Montserrat,Arial,sans-serif!important;font-size:10px!important;font-weight:700!important;letter-spacing:.14em!important;text-decoration:none!important;text-transform:uppercase!important;transition:background .2s ease}.pur-event-card__btn:hover{background:#6ccdd1!important}.pur-events__nav{gap:12px;margin-top:.25rem}.pur-events__nav,.pur-events__nav-btn{align-items:center;display:flex;justify-content:center}.pur-events__nav-btn{background:#fff!important;border:1px solid #d3d1c7!important;border-radius:50%!important;color:#5f5e5a;cursor:pointer;font-size:18px;height:36px;transition:border-color .2s,color .2s;width:36px}.pur-events__nav-btn:hover{border-color:#88dbdf!important;color:#88dbdf}.pur-events__nav-btn:disabled{cursor:default;opacity:.3}.pur-events__nav-label{color:#b4b2a9;font-family:Montserrat,Arial,sans-serif;font-size:10px;font-weight:600;letter-spacing:.15em;min-width:36px;text-align:center;text-transform:uppercase}.pur-events__dots{display:flex;gap:6px}.pur-events__dot{background:#d3d1c7;border:none!important;border-radius:50%!important;cursor:pointer;height:7px;padding:0;transition:background .2s,transform .2s;width:7px}.pur-events__dot.active{background:#88dbdf;transform:scale(1.3)}@media (max-width:780px){.pur-events__track{gap:16px;padding:8px 24px}.pur-event-card{flex:0 0 260px}.pur-countdown{margin:2rem 16px}}@media (max-width:480px){.pur-events__track{padding:8px 16px}.pur-event-card{flex:0 0 85vw}}